25 вопросов на собеседовании для Администратора баз данных

Каждая компания, независимо от ее размера, производит данные, которые становятся активом. Данные в основном используются, чтобы помочь предприятиям принимать обоснованные решения, которые позволяют различным сферам деятельности компании улучшать свои стратегии.

Например, данные помогают маркетинговым командам запускать успешные кампании. Это также помогает директивам компании оптимизировать бизнес-операции при одновременном сокращении затрат. По этим и другим причинам роль администратора базы данных (DBA) стала критически важной. Их основная ответственность - обеспечить безопасность и доступность базы данных компании за счет организации и хранения ее критически важных данных.

Помните, что вы нанимаете кого-то, у кого в руках будут все данные вашей компании. Они должны знать технические аспекты, но они также должны адаптироваться к культуре вашей компании, реагировать в сложных условиях и, помимо прочего, брать на себя ответственность за свою работу. Эти вопросы собеседования с администратором базы данных разделены на 5 основных сегментов, чтобы помочь вам определить кандидата, который идеально подходит для этой роли.

Кто такой администратор базы данных?

Неважно, какая у вас компания - B2B или B2C. Вам всегда будут нужны данные, чтобы разработать лучшие стратегии или просто понять, где находится ваш бизнес. Например, если у вас есть магазин электронной коммерции, анализ ваших данных поможет вам глубже понять, как думают потребители. В конце концов, это поможет вам делать прогнозы для будущих продуктов, компании или рекламных акций. Кроме того, обеспечение безопасности данных ваших клиентов также является ключом к тому, чтобы они доверяли вам и продолжали приобретать ваши услуги или продукты.

Знаете ли вы, что 93% компаний, которые потеряли свои центры обработки данных на 10 дней (или более) из-за катастрофы, должны были объявить о банкротстве в течение одного года после катастрофы? Кроме того, средняя стоимость утечки данных для малого бизнеса составляет от 36 000 до 50 000 долларов.

Вы можете подумать, что ваши данные организованы, но имейте в виду, что одно - это организация и доступность, а другое - обеспечение безопасности. Администрирование данных - это не то, чему вы легко можете научиться из роликов на YouTube. Вам нужны узкоспециализированные навыки и глубокое понимание информационных технологий и информатики. Или более простая (и более эффективная) стратегия - нанять администратора базы данных.

Основные обязанности администратора базы данных:

  • Создавать и настраивать базы данных для хранения и организации информации о компании.
  • Обновлять и адаптировать существующие базы данных в соответствии с потребностями компании.
  • Устанавливать программы безопасности и выполнять регулярное резервное копирование, чтобы избежать утечки данных любого типа.
  • Предоставлять пользователям разные уровни доступа.
  • Писать документацию по базе данных, которая включает стандарты данных, процедуры и определения.

Как подготовиться к собеседованию с администратором базы данных
Любое интервью, независимо от роли, требует подготовки. Однако на технические должности, такие как администратор базы данных, требуются интервьюеры, знающие предмет области. У вас может быть талантливая команда по персоналу, но если никто из них ничего не знает об управлении данными, вы рискуете нанять кандидата, не подходящего для этой должности.

Вот 3 совета, которые помогут вам подготовиться к собеседованию с администраторами баз данных:

1. Точно знайте, что вы ищете
Зачем вам нужен администратор базы данных? Как администратор базы данных поможет вашему бизнесу?

Эти два вопроса кажутся простыми, но они действительно помогают вам задуматься, если вы понимаете два основных понятия при приеме на работу на техническую должность: почему и как. После того, как вы это изучите, напишите список навыков, сертификатов, возможностей и аспектов, которые вы ищете в кандидате. Это поможет вам сосредоточиться и узнать во время собеседования, готов ли кандидат перейти к следующему этапу процесса найма или продолжить поиск.

2. Подготовьте и стандартизируйте список вопросов.
Еще один совет, зная, кого вы ищете, - заранее подготовьте вопросы. Не обязательно только технические вопросы, но и те, кто поможет вам узнать больше о кандидате и его способах работы. Имейте в виду, что идея этих вопросов состоит в том, чтобы выяснить, отвечает ли кандидат всем вашим требованиям. Например, в этом случае вопросы собеседования с администратором базы данных должны охватывать все, от языков программирования и сертификатов, которые им необходимы, до опыта создания эффективных баз данных и управления ими для других компаний. Кроме того, вы всегда должны поддерживать качество контента при подготовке вопроса к собеседованию. Таким образом, ваши вопросы будут проверены на предмет контекстных или грамматических ошибок, и вы будете готовы к тому, чтобы задавать вопросы как можно лучше.

3. Нетехническая подготовка? Попросить помощи!
Если у вас нет технической подготовки, мы рекомендуем вам обратиться за помощью. Вы можете нанять администратора базы данных через платформы для фрилансеров, которые проверят кандидатов в ИТ и предоставят вам того, кто вам нужен. Или же обратитесь в агентство по подбору ит персонала, которое поможет вам найти нужного ит специалиста с необходимыми навыками для достижения успеха. Выбор за вами!

Хороший администратор базы данных - это не просто тот, у кого потрясающее резюме, большие навыки и тысячи сертификатов. Это также человек с коммуникативными навыками, который знает, как работать в команде, как получать и давать рекомендации другим. Наем технических должностей связан не только с самой «технической» частью, но и с человеческой частью кандидатов. Эти 25 вопросов на собеседовании с администратором баз данных разделены на 4 разных сектора, которые помогут вам провести полную оценку и выбрать подходящего кандидата для вашего проекта.

Ситуационные вопросы

1. Как бы вы справились с потерей данных во время миграции базы данных?
Потеря данных - одна из ситуаций, когда администраторы баз данных испытывают наибольшую нагрузку, особенно если проект миграции отстает от графика. Этот вопрос поможет вам узнать больше о том, как кандидат ведет себя под давлением и стрессом, и, что более важно, какие стратегии он использует для преодоления этой ситуации - понимание того, как устранять неполадки и восстанавливать данные, является важной функцией, которую должны знать все роли администраторов баз данных.

2. Нам нужно создать новую базу данных для записей наших сотрудников. Как бы вы определили требования к системному хранилищу?
В идеале кандидат начнет отвечать на этот вопрос с понимания того, как выглядит ваша текущая ситуация с базой данных. Осознав это, они могут начать предлагать и определять требования к системному хранилищу. Нет правильного или неправильного ответа. Это зависит от вашей компании, но, что более важно, с этим вопросом вы хотите узнать, как кандидат, если бы это была реальная ситуация, отреагирует на ваши требования и какие решения для баз данных он предлагает на основе своих знаний и опыта.

3. Расскажите мне о своем процессе устранения неполадок с базой данных.
Устранение неполадок - обычная задача для большинства администраторов баз данных, поэтому крайне важно нанять того, кто сможет сделать это эффективно. Они должны ответить, рассказав вам, каков их процесс выявления и решения проблемы. Вам следует искать надежный процесс; если кандидат дает общий ответ, это может быть красным флажком. Постарайтесь подробно понять, на что похож этот процесс, как они используют свои доступные ресурсы / инструменты и свой опыт.

4. Какие меры вы бы предприняли для защиты наших баз данных от внешних угроз?
Кибератаки существуют с начала эры Интернета. Теперь, когда цифровая среда продолжает расти, защита данных вашей компании и клиентов становится еще более актуальной. Этот вопрос приобретает такую актуальность, и кандидат должен быть в состоянии дать вам различные стратегии защиты ваших баз данных от любых типов угроз. Будь то установка HTTPS-сервера, использование мониторинга базы данных в реальном времени или развертывание протоколов шифрования данных, ответ может варьироваться в зависимости от знаний и опыта кандидата.

5. С какими типами баз данных вы работаете?
Существует много различных типов инфраструктур баз данных, поэтому с помощью этого вопроса вы подтвердите, обладает ли кандидат тем опытом, который вы ищете. Например, если ваша база данных построена с использованием MySQL или Oracle, важно увидеть, насколько кандидаты знакомы с этими серверами баз данных и их уровень знаний.

Вопросы по ролям

6. Что такое агент SQL?
Агент SQL - это механизм планирования заданий в SQL Server. Задания можно запланировать на определенное время или при наступлении определенного события. Также работы могут быть выполнены по запросу. Агент SQL обычно используется для планирования административных заданий, таких как резервное копирование.

7. Что такое DBCC?
Операторы DBBC представляют собой команды консоли базы данных и имеют четыре различных области:

  • Команды обслуживания: это те команды, которые позволяют администратору базы данных выполнять действия по обслуживанию (например, сжатие файла).
  • Информационные команды: предоставление обратной связи по базе данных.
  • Команды проверки: Включите команды, которые проверяют базу данных, такие как неизменно популярный CHECKDB.
  • Разные команды: те, кого нельзя отнести к трем предыдущим областям. Они включают такие инструкции, как помощь DBCC.

8. Объясните, что такое системная база данных и база данных пользователей.
Системная база данных - это база данных по умолчанию, устанавливаемая при установке сервера SQL. Существует 4 системные базы данных: Master, MSDB, TempDB и Model. С другой стороны, база данных пользователей - это база данных, созданная для хранения данных и начала работы с ними.

9. В каких режимах работы выполняется зеркальное отображение базы данных? В чем разница между ними?
Зеркальное отображение базы данных работает в 2 рабочих режимах: режим высокой безопасности и режим высокой производительности. Первый (режим высокой безопасности) гарантирует, что основная и зеркальная база данных находятся в синхронизированном состоянии; то есть транзакции совершаются одновременно на обоих серверах для обеспечения согласованности. Второй (режим высокой производительности) гарантирует, что основная база данных работает быстрее, не дожидаясь, пока зеркальная база данных зафиксирует транзакции.

10. Объясните назначение модельной базы данных.
База данных модели состоит из шаблона для всех баз данных, созданных в системе SQL. Если исходная база данных модели изменена, все последующие базы данных, созданные в системах, будут отражать изменения. Однако базы данных, созданные ранее, этого не сделают.

Вопросы о соответствии GDPR

11. В чем разница между обработчиком данных и контроллером данных?
Законодательство распространяется на два разных типа дескрипторов данных: процессоры и контроллеры. Согласно определениям, приведенным в Общем регламенте защиты данных (GDPR), контролер - это лицо, которое определяет цель, условия и средства обработки персональных данных. С другой стороны, процессор - это организация, которая обрабатывает персональные данные от имени контролера.

12. Объясните, что такое запросы на право доступа.
Запрос о праве доступа (статья 15 - GDPR) дает людям возможность узнать, обрабатывает ли контроллер данных их личные данные, и, если это так, что это за информация и почему она обрабатывается.

Физические лица имеют право на получение копии соответствующих личных данных, которая не обязательно зависит от того, является ли кто-то работодателем, работником или самозанятым.

В ДДПР есть исключения, которые в основном касаются вопросов, представляющих общественный интерес (например, расследования преступлений).

Более того, в декларации 47 GDPR говорится, что предотвращение мошенничества является законным интересом для обработки персональных данных: «Обработка персональных данных строго необходима для предотвращения мошенничества также представляет собой законный интерес соответствующего контролера данных».

Даже в целях мошенничества контролер должен доказать наличие законного интереса и необходимость обработки персональных данных.

13. Всем ли предприятиям нужен сотрудник по защите данных (DPO)?
DPO должен быть назначен в трех конкретных случаях:

1) органы государственной власти, 2) организации, осуществляющие широкомасштабный систематический мониторинг, или 3) организации, которые занимаются масштабной обработкой конфиденциальных персональных данных. Если ваша организация не попадает в эти категории, нет необходимости назначать DPO.

14. Может ли кто-нибудь получить доступ к личным данным в вашей компании? Или есть разные уровни доступа?
Как контроллер или процессор вы имеете право обрабатывать данные. Однако это не означает, что все сотрудники могут получить к ним доступ - данные должны быть доступны только тем сотрудникам компании, чья должность требует от них наличия этих прав. Есть разные уровни доступа; в то время как некоторые люди могут иметь полный доступ с правами изменения или удаления данных, другие смогут только просматривать данные.

15. Как вы можете собирать данные (по электронной почте, для отслеживания активности и т. д.)?
Это необходимый шаг для проверки различных способов сбора данных. Тем не менее, вам в первую очередь необходимо правильно провести аудит ваших потоков данных и убедиться, что вы выполняете все юридические обязательства, такие как получение надлежащего согласия на обработку, предоставление субъекту данных информации, указанной в GDPR, и т. д.

Поведенческие вопросы

16. Как вы узнаете о новых приложениях / ресурсах?
Администратор данных и любая другая ИТ-роль должны быть в курсе новых ресурсов, появляющихся на рынке. Индустрия постоянно меняется, и большой ошибкой было бы нанять администратора баз данных, который все еще работает со старыми версиями баз данных. Убедитесь, что они знают обо всех изменениях, будь то из-за того, что они являются частью сообществ, групп Facebook или просто потому, что они постоянно находятся в курсе.

17. Какой из ваших проектов был самым сложным? Почему это было сложно и в чем заключалась ваша роль?
Проект может быть сложным по разным причинам. Может быть, им было трудно справиться с некоторыми членами команды, а может быть, из-за внешней ситуации они боролись с дедлайнами. Хотя это частый вопрос, это отличный способ узнать больше о кандидате и его социальных навыках.

18. Можете ли вы рассказать мне о случае, когда вы допустили ошибку, и как вы ее исправили? Можно ли как-нибудь предотвратить это?
Все люди. Если вы встречаетесь с кандидатом, который дает вам идеальные, простые ответы, хотите верьте, хотите нет, это может быть красным флажком. Вместо ответа типа «Нет, я не делал ошибок, я идеален» поищите кого-нибудь честного. Уловка этого вопроса заключается не только в самой ошибке, но и в том, «как». Узнав, как они работали под давлением и как они его решили. Кроме того, знание того, как это предотвратить, также является хорошим признаком того, что они точно поняли, что произошло, и поэтому маловероятно, что это повторится с ними снова.

19. Если бы вам приходилось работать в команде с людьми с непростым характером и постоянным конфликтом, как бы вы справились с этим?
Вы можете иметь сильную личность с четкими лидерскими качествами и критическим мышлением, но при этом уметь сочувствовать и слушать других членов команды. Независимо от того, обладает ли ваш кандидат сильным или более расслабленным характером, с помощью этого вопроса вы хотите узнать, как он справляется с разными мнениями. Это поможет вам лучше понять особенности личности кандидата и то, как он может справляться с конфликтом.

20. Представьте, что вам нужно разработать систему базы данных для важного клиента. У вас сжатые сроки, поэтому вся команда упорно работает. Однако вы заметили, что, поскольку ваш босс больше беспокоится о сроках, он проигнорировал некоторые аспекты. Например, он не использовал средства SQL для защиты целостности данных и даже решил не проводить регулярных тестов для ускорения процесса. Как бы вы с этим справились?

В идеале в вашей команде нет такого лидера. Однако на самом деле этот воображаемый лидер может быть коллегой, который не заботится о качестве проекта, но больше заботится о его завершении, чтобы получить зарплату. Этот вопрос поможет вам понять приоритеты кандидата и его поведение в этой среде. Независимо от того, высказываются ли они за то, что правильно, или просто соглашаются с тем, что босс является хозяином и командиром, и если он говорит, что он прав, он прав.

Вопросы о личном опыте

21. Каков ваш опыт работы с серверами баз данных?
В этом вопросе вы ищите больше информации о том, насколько кандидат знаком с серверами баз данных, как они использовали каждую систему, будь то Oracle, Microsoft или любая другая, а также о многолетнем опыте работы с ними. .

22. С каким наибольшим количеством серверов баз данных вы работали?
Если вы большая организация, этот вопрос идеально подходит для вас. Одно дело - работать на малый бизнес с небольшим центром обработки данных. Совсем другое дело - иметь дело с центром обработки данных большой корпорации. Если кандидат работал только с небольшими центрами обработки данных, вы рискуете, что они не знают, как справиться с вашим, или столкнутся с постоянными проблемами. Важно узнать больше о размерах их предыдущих компаний, количестве серверов и их средах.

23. Работали ли вы с локальными базами данных, облачными базами данных или с обоими?
Большинство предприятий в настоящее время переходят на облачную инфраструктуру. Если это ваш случай, то важно узнать больше об опыте кандидата в работе с облачными базами данных и узнать, в какой среде они работают лучше всего. Кроме того, предположим, что ваша организация имеет локальную базу данных и собирается перейти на гибридную базу данных. В этом случае вам необходимо выяснить, сможет ли кандидат поддержать ваши долгосрочные цели.

24. Почему вы выбрали администрирование базы данных?
Страсть - вот что заставляет людей процветать. Но не у всех есть вдохновляющая, удивительная история о том, как они выбрали конкретную карьеру. Однако интересно узнать больше о прошлом кандидата и, в этом случае, узнать, как он попал в эту карьеру и нравится ли ему это или нет. Вы также можете спросить об их образовании и о том, где они узнали об управлении базами данных.

25. Опишите свой рабочий процесс без непосредственного надзора.
Если вы не являетесь микроменеджером над всеми в офисе, важно найти кого-то, кто может работать независимо. Более того, при приеме на работу разработчиков, работающих удаленно , им необходимо все время работать без непосредственного надзора. Узнайте об их рабочем процессе и рабочем процессе, если они организованы и имеют четкую повестку дня своих приоритетов или ожидают ли они от руководителей каждый день указывать им, что делать.

Подбор ИТ-специалистов может быть болезненным, если у вас нет технического образования. Мы не собираемся приукрашивать это для вас. Если вы не знаете, что такое Oracle, MySQL, Microsoft SQL, MongoDB, то, скорее всего, вы поверите любому кандидату, который скажет вам, что они могут это сделать.
HR Блог для IT рекрутера в Телеграм
Хочешь всегда получать новые статьи, бесплатные материалы и полезные HR лайфхаки! Подписывайся на нас в Telegram! С нами подбор ит персонала становится проще ;)
Хотите найти талантливого сотрудника?
Оставьте заявку и получите в подарок список вопросов для сбора рекомендаций на кандидата